Twittering Tale #18 – 21 February 2017

Alone at last she looks, and says its been so long. Alone at last he looks, says I’m glad today has arrived. Alone at last, holding hands. Written for: https://katmyrman.com/2017/02/21/twittering-tales-18-21-february-2017/
